Details
The QIS protocol aims to solve the governance problem in decentralized AI systems. Unlike blockchain consensus mechanisms or federated learning, QIS takes a unique approach by running three separate elections to define the network's behavior. The first election elects a Pattern Curator, who is responsible for defining the similarity template - the set of variables and their ranges that determine which cases belong together. This template becomes the routing key for the entire network. For example, in the lung cancer use case, the curator defines fields like stage, histology, driver mutation, PD-L1 expression, and ECOG status as the key variables to group similar cases. The curator's decision on the similarity template is a critical one, as it shapes how the network will organize and route information. This is not a purely technical decision, but rather requires domain expertise to determine the most relevant factors for the given use case. By having a separate election to select the curator, QIS ensures that the network's core organizing principle is defined by subject matter experts rather than a central authority.
